Swarm Robotics: Harnessing the Power of Collective Behavior
Swarm robotics is an emerging field of research that focuses on the design, development, and application of multi-robot systems. These systems consist of a large number of relatively simple, physically embodied agents that are capable of coordinating their actions to achieve a common goal. Inspired by the collective behavior observed in social insects such as ants, bees, and termites, swarm robotics aims to harness the power of self-organization, scalability, and robustness inherent in these natural systems.
The concept of swarm robotics is rooted in the study of swarm intelligence, which is the collective behavior of decentralized, self-organized systems. In nature, swarm intelligence can be observed in the way that ants find the shortest path to a food source, how bees collectively decide on the location of a new nest, or how termites construct complex structures without a central blueprint. These behaviors emerge from the local interactions between individual insects and their environment, without the need for a central controller or leader. Researchers in swarm robotics seek to apply these principles to the design of artificial systems, with the goal of creating robots that can work together to perform tasks that would be difficult or impossible for a single robot to accomplish.
One of the main advantages of swarm robotics is its inherent scalability. Because the behavior of the swarm emerges from the local interactions between individual robots, the system can easily be scaled up or down by adding or removing robots. This means that a swarm robotic system can be easily adapted to different tasks and environments, making it a highly versatile solution for a wide range of applications. Additionally, the decentralized nature of swarm robotics means that there is no single point of failure in the system. If one robot fails or is removed from the swarm, the remaining robots can continue to function and adapt to the new situation, ensuring that the overall performance of the system is maintained.
Another key advantage of swarm robotics is its robustness. In a swarm robotic system, each robot is relatively simple and inexpensive, which means that the overall cost of the system can be kept low. Furthermore, the simplicity of the individual robots means that they can be easily mass-produced, making swarm robotics an attractive option for large-scale applications. The robustness of swarm robotics also extends to the system’s ability to adapt to changes in its environment. Because the behavior of the swarm emerges from the local interactions between individual robots, the system can quickly adapt to new situations and recover from disturbances.
Swarm robotics has a wide range of potential applications, from environmental monitoring and disaster response to agriculture and transportation. For example, a swarm of robots could be used to monitor air quality in a city, with each robot equipped with sensors to detect pollutants. The robots could then communicate with each other to build a real-time map of air quality, allowing authorities to identify problem areas and take appropriate action. Similarly, a swarm of robots could be deployed in a disaster-stricken area to search for survivors, with each robot using its sensors to detect signs of life and communicating with the rest of the swarm to coordinate a rescue effort.
In conclusion, swarm robotics is a promising field of research that has the potential to revolutionize the way we approach complex tasks and challenges. By harnessing the power of collective behavior, swarm robotic systems can offer a scalable, robust, and adaptable solution for a wide range of applications. As research in this area continues to advance, we can expect to see the emergence of new and innovative applications for swarm robotics, transforming the way we live and work.